RT null T1 Seed Capital Assistance Facility - [Factsheet] A1 United Nations Environment Programme, K1 capital K1 development finance K1 energy resource K1 renewable energy source K1 energy efficiency K1 equity K1 investment K1 Africa K1 Asia K1 Kenya K1 Namibia K1 Nigeria K1 South Africa K1 Rwanda K1 United Republic of Tanzania K1 Uganda K1 Cambodia K1 India K1 Indonesia K1 Philippines K1 Viet Nam YR 2020 FD 2020 LK https://wedocs.unep.org/handle/20.500.11822/31625 UL https://wedocs.unep.org/handle/20.500.11822/31625 NO The Seed Capital Assistance Facility (SCAF) is a multi-donor trust fund managed by the United Nations Environment Programme(UNEP) and backed by the German Federal Environment Ministry together with the British Department for International Development(DFID). It makes finance available during the development phase of projects being carried out in developing countries and emergingeconomies that are aimed at promoting the use of climate-friendly technologies (e.g. renewable energies, energy efficiency).
